Diavik Diamond Mines gets its supplies

Canadian Mining Journal Staff | April 1, 2013 | 12:00 am

Diavik Diamond Mines Inc., operator of the Diavik Diamond Mine in Canada’s Northwest Territories, has once again resupplied its mine by transporting approximately 3,500 loads of fuel, cement, and other supplies up the 2013 winter road.

The Tibbitt to Contwoyto Winter Road opened January 30 to initial light loads. As a result of the coldest winter in 20 years, opening-day ice thickness of 86 cm (34 inches) was the most ever and was 15 cm (6 inches) thicker than what would normally be expected. NUNA Logistics constructed and maintained the 385 km ice road and Det’on Cho Scarlet provided security. Det’on Cho Construction and subcontractor RTL constructed the 141 km secondary route from Gibbs Lake to Prosperous Lake.

Currently in its 32nd year of operations, the ice road is open for approximately 10 weeks each winter and is a joint venture managed by Diavik Diamond Mines Inc., BHP Billiton Diamonds Inc., and De Beers Canada Inc.
